Variations of Loading Icons and Their Meanings
When programs are thinking, they often present loading icons to indicate that something is taking place. These icons can change widely in appearance, and each type often conveys a distinct message. Popular types include the spinning circle, which signifies persistent activity, and the loading bar, which illustrates the proportion of a task that has been completed. Other types, like the animated arrow, suggest at upcoming movement or progress. Recognizing these different icon types can assist users gauge the situation of a system check here and control their anticipation.

Creating Effective Loading Indicators
When users experience a loading indicator, they're essentially communicating with your application's progress. A well-designed loading indicator can transform the user experience by providing visibility into the process and mitigating perceived wait times. Consider the following aspects when designing effective loading indicators:
- Visibility: Make sure your indicator is readily apparent to users, without being overly distracting or intrusive.{
- {Feedback: Provide clear feedback on the loading situation. A simple progress bar can be more informative than a static icon.
- Context: Tailor your indicator to the specific context. For example, a spinning animation might be suitable for quick operations, while a pulsing effect could suggest longer processes.
In essence,, effective loading indicators reduce user anxiety and build trust in your application.
